Whether you’re coordinating a concert, a corporate trade show, or a wedding, ensuring seamless communication among team members is essential. One of the most reliable tools for achieving this is the two-way radio. By offering immediate, clear, and efficient communication, two-way radios serve as indispensable resources for event organizers. Below, we explore four key benefits of two-way radios for event communication.
Instant Communication
When time is of the essence, there is no room for delays. Two-way radios provide instant communication with the press of a button, allowing team members to connect immediately. Instead of having to dial numbers or navigate apps on cell phones, radio users can send and deliver messages in real time. This feature is invaluable during critical situations, such as managing crowd control, addressing safety concerns, or relaying urgent updates. Whether it’s notifying security about a potential issue or directing volunteers to a specific location, the ability to communicate without delay allows you to maintain control and keep the event running smoothly.
Reliability
Event venues often include areas with poor or no cellular reception, such as basements, parking lots, or remote outdoor spaces. Relying solely on cell phones in such situations can lead to communication breakdowns, which can be disastrous for event organizers. Two-way radios, however, operate independently of mobile networks. Their robust signals provide seamless communication even in areas where cell service is unreliable. This reliability allows event teams to stay connected at all times, no matter the location. From large-scale outdoor music festivals to indoor conferences, two-way radios provide clear communication and consistent functionality to keep operations moving along.
Group Communication
Coordinating large teams often requires the ability to speak to multiple people at once. Two-way radios allow for simultaneous group communication, making it easy to relay information without repeatedly contacting individual team members. For example, if a stage manager needs to quickly notify all crew members of a schedule change, they can do so with a single broadcast through a radio channel. Similarly, security teams can stay updated on potential issues by communicating in real time as a group. This capability streamlines communication and ensures that everyone receives the same information at the same time, reducing the risk of miscommunication or missed critical updates.
Cost-Effective
For event organizers working within tight budgets, keeping communication costs low is essential. Using cell phones for event communication can quickly become expensive, especially when factoring in data usage, calling plans, and device rentals. Two-way radios, on the other hand, offer a cost-effective alternative. Radios typically require a one-time purchase or rental fee, with no recurring costs like monthly phone bills. Additionally, they can withstand demanding environments, reducing maintenance and replacement expenses over time. For multi-day events or recurring productions, radios are an affordable option that supports efficient communication without breaking the bank.
